What is rental revenue management?
Revenue management is the discipline of pricing a fixed set of assets — your vehicles — to earn as much as sensibly possible from them over time. A car parked on your forecourt is a perishable asset: a day it is not rented is revenue you can never recover. The job of revenue management software is to give you the rate structures and the visibility to reduce those wasted days and to charge appropriately for the days a vehicle is on rent.
In practice this splits into two halves. The first is setting prices: defining what a vehicle costs per day, per week, or over a longer term, and adjusting those numbers for seasons, promotions and demand. The second is measuring results: attributing revenue to individual bookings and vehicles so you can tell which parts of the fleet are working and which are not. Vehicle Rental System supports both halves with the same underlying records, so the prices you set and the revenue you report never drift apart into two disagreeing spreadsheets.
Crucially, revenue management is not the same as accounting. Accounting is concerned with statutory reporting, tax and the full picture of costs. Revenue management is an operational discipline focused on pricing and utilisation. The two overlap, but conflating them is where a lot of rental businesses go wrong — they look at a bank balance and mistake it for an understanding of which vehicles are profitable.
Revenue vs. gross booking value vs. net profit
These three numbers are routinely confused, and the confusion costs money. It is worth being precise, because the software is precise about it too.
- Gross booking value (GBV) is the total amount that changes hands around a booking. It can include the rental charge, a refundable security deposit, and any pass-through items. GBV looks large and flattering, but a big slice of it — the deposit — is money you are holding on trust and will give back. GBV is a cash-flow figure, not an earnings figure.
- Revenue is the rental income you actually earn from the booking: the rate for the hire period, plus genuine chargeable extras. The returned deposit is not revenue. This is the number that belongs in a revenue report, and it is the number Vehicle Rental System sums when it shows revenue per booking or per vehicle.
- Net profit is what remains after your costs: vehicle finance or depreciation, maintenance, insurance, cleaning, staff, location and platform costs. A vehicle can generate strong revenue and still be unprofitable if it is expensive to run. Net profit depends on cost data that the platform does not fully hold today, so the honest position is that the software reports revenue accurately and gives you the inputs for a profit calculation — it does not claim to compute true net profit for you.
| Concept | What it includes | What it is good for | What it is not |
|---|---|---|---|
| Gross booking value | Rental charge + deposit + pass-through items | Understanding cash movement | Not a measure of earnings |
| Revenue | Rental charge + genuine chargeable extras | Comparing vehicles and periods | Not profit; excludes costs |
| Net profit | Revenue minus all operating costs | Judging true financial performance | Not fully computed in-platform today |
Why labour this? Because a fleet owner who tracks GBV will feel richer than they are and may underprice; one who tracks revenue but forgets costs may keep an expensive vehicle that quietly loses money. Clear definitions are the foundation of every decision below.

Rate structures: daily, weekly and long-term
The starting point of revenue management is a rate structure that reflects how people actually rent. Vehicle Rental System supports layered rental pricing as an available capability Available , so a single vehicle can carry more than one rate:
- Daily rate — the headline price for short hires, and the anchor for everything else.
- Weekly rate — a discounted effective daily price for longer bookings, rewarding commitment and reducing turnaround costs like cleaning and paperwork.
- Long-term rate — monthly or extended pricing for corporate hire, subscriptions or relocation customers, where a lower daily figure is worth it for guaranteed utilisation.
The reason to formalise these in software rather than negotiate them each time is consistency. When rates live in the system, every staff member quotes the same price, the weekly break-points are applied automatically, and your revenue reports are comparable because they were all generated the same way. Security deposits Available attach to each booking separately, which keeps the deposit out of your revenue figures where it belongs.
Seasonal pricing and discount management
Demand is not flat across the year, and neither should your prices be. Seasonal and promotional pricing is a partially-available capability Partial — you can apply seasonal or promotional rates today, within some scope and plan limits. Typical uses:
- Peak seasons — raise rates for tourist high season, long weekends or local festivals when demand outstrips supply.
- Off-peak recovery — lower rates or run promotions in quiet weeks so vehicles earn something rather than sitting idle.
- Length-of-hire discounts — the weekly and long-term rates above are, in effect, structured discounts that you control rather than improvise.
- Loyalty or partner pricing — agreed rates for repeat customers and travel-agency partners.
The discipline that matters here is treating discounts as deliberate revenue decisions, not ad-hoc giveaways. A discount applied in the system is visible in the booking record and flows into your revenue reports, so you can later see whether the promotion that filled quiet weeks actually earned more than leaving the vehicles parked. A discount scribbled on a paper agreement teaches you nothing.
Revenue per booking and revenue per vehicle
Once rates are structured, the payoff is measurement. Two figures do most of the work.
Revenue per booking tells you the earning power of an individual rental. It is the rental charge for the hire period plus genuine extras, and it lets you compare a three-day daily hire against a two-week long-term booking on equal terms. A high revenue-per-booking figure is not automatically better — a long booking at a low daily rate can beat several short ones once you account for the cleaning and admin between hires.
Revenue per vehicle is the number that changes how owners think. Because every booking is linked to a specific vehicle, summing the revenue of all bookings for that vehicle over a period gives you exactly what that asset earned. Set that against how many days it was available, and you can see which vehicles pull their weight. Utilisation and idle capacity
Revenue per vehicle only makes sense next to utilisation — the share of available days a vehicle was actually on rent. A vehicle earning modest revenue at 90% utilisation may be a quiet star; a vehicle earning more at 40% utilisation may have plenty of headroom or may be priced wrong. The fleet utilisation view is partially available Partial and is designed to surface exactly this: which vehicles are working, which are idle, and where a rate change or a relocation between branches might help.
Utilisation also protects you from a common trap. Chasing the highest daily rate can lower utilisation so much that total revenue falls — an expensive car rented eight days a month can earn less than a cheaper one rented twenty-five. Revenue management is the balance of rate and utilisation, and you need both numbers in front of you to strike it.
Worked example: a fleet owner comparing revenue per vehicle
Consider Anaya, who owns a six-car fleet across two branches. At month end she used to look at one combined total. With revenue-per-vehicle reporting, she sees each car separately for a 30-day month:
| Vehicle | Days on rent | Utilisation | Revenue | Revenue / available day |
|---|---|---|---|---|
| Hatchback A (economy) | 26 | 87% | 46,800 | 1,560 |
| Hatchback B (economy) | 24 | 80% | 43,200 | 1,440 |
| Sedan C (mid) | 19 | 63% | 47,500 | 1,583 |
| Sedan D (mid) | 11 | 37% | 27,500 | 917 |
| SUV E (premium) | 14 | 47% | 49,000 | 1,633 |
| SUV F (premium) | 9 | 30% | 31,500 | 1,050 |
The combined total is 245,500 across the fleet — the single number Anaya used to see. Broken out, the story is sharper:
- The economy hatchbacks earn less per booking but rent almost every day. High utilisation makes them dependable revenue.
- Sedan C is the quiet winner: solid utilisation and the strongest revenue per available day. Anaya considers adding a second car like it.
- Sedan D and SUV F both earn respectable total revenue but sit idle more than half the month. The question is whether that is a pricing problem (rates too high for the branch), a placement problem (wrong branch), or a demand problem (too much premium supply).
- SUV E earns the most revenue per available day, so premium demand clearly exists — which strengthens the case that SUV F's problem is price or placement, not the category.
Here is the honesty that matters: these are revenue figures, not profit. The two SUVs likely cost far more to finance, insure and service than the hatchbacks. Anaya cannot conclude the SUVs are her best assets from revenue alone — she would need to set each vehicle's costs against its revenue to find net profit, and those cost inputs live largely outside the platform today. What the software gives her is a trustworthy, per-vehicle revenue foundation and the utilisation context to ask the right questions. Acting on this, she trials a lower off-peak rate on SUV F and moves Sedan D to the busier branch, then compares next month's report to see if the changes worked.
